Q: Is 89,404 a Composite Number?

 A: Yes, 89,404 is a composite number.

Why is 89,404 a composite number?

A composite number is a number that can be divided evenly by more numbers than 1 and itself. It is the opposite of a prime number.

The number 89,404 can be evenly divided by 1 2 4 7 14 28 31 62 103 124 206 217 412 434 721 868 1,442 2,884 3,193 6,386 12,772 22,351 44,702 and 89,404, with no remainder.

Since 89,404 cannot be divided by just 1 and 89,404, it is a composite number.
